I, the undersigned, agree to abide by the following rules and will obey any and all additional instructions given by the staff of Oglala Lakota College (OLC) Learning Resource Center (LRC). Please see the OLC Archivist if you have any questions.
RULES:
1. All food, drink, tobacco products and candy are prohibited in the research room.
2. Patrons must properly store all backpacks, briefcases, purses, coats, hats, etc. immediately upon entering the research room. Lockers and a coat rack are provided for storage of personal items. All belongings that are brought into the archives are subject to search by an LRC staff member before they are taken out of the archives, including bound pads of paper used for note taking.
3. Only pencils, paper, portable computers and portable recorders may be used for note taking. Extra pencils and paper are available to borrow while using the research room. Portable computers and recorders are not provided.
4. All archival research must be done at the research table in the archives, with the exception of microform research and when the archivist gives permission otherwise. Reference books in the archives are not to leave the research room.
5. The archivist or a LRC staff person will provide each researcher one box at a time. The LRC staff will do their best to have all requested materials on-hand and be available to take the box the researcher has completed and provide the next one the researcher requests.
6. Keep the existing order of archival materials within each folder and box. Do not lean on books or documents or mark pages in any way, unless with a strip of paper provided by an LRC staff member. If there is any doubt as to the order of materials, suspicion of missing materials, or apparent damage to materials please notify the archivist immediately. When needed, gloves will be provided for the handling of some archival materials (e.g., photographs). Please follow the archivist’s instruction regarding any special handling techniques.
7. Make duplication requests with the archivist. Materials may be photocopied and/or photoduplicated, but the archives has reasonable restrictions to protect fragile, damaged or restricted materials. OLC abides by all existing copyright laws and will not knowingly violate these laws. Please see the Request For Service form for further information.
8. The use of certain collections and materials may be restricted by statute, by office of origin, by the archives, or by the donors. The researcher assumes full responsibility for fulfilling the terms connected with any restricted material. For the protection of its collections the archives reserves the right to restrict the use of materials which are not arranged or are being arranged, materials of exceptional value (cultural or monetary), and especially fragile materials.

In giving permission to copy, quote from, or publish a manuscript or other material, the archives does not surrender its own right to print such material or to grant permission to others to print it. The researcher assumes full responsibility for the use of the material and for conformity to the laws of libel and copyright or publication rights and restrictions.
